Output 38388880ec95a115b060f5150995a645436a0c2807e88cf8f960d6509ac49945:3

value
438426
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 811ed593651118e24e738a690445bc20c30845ce09c1d065944b1185c3443d5b
address
bc1psy0dtym9zyvwynnn3f5sg3duyrpss3wwp8qaqev5fvgcts6y84ds7yh4gn
transaction
38388880ec95a115b060f5150995a645436a0c2807e88cf8f960d6509ac49945
spent
true